Dinalynn CONTACT the Host, Dinalynn: hello@thelanguageofplay.com ABOUT THE GUEST: Michael Hingson, blind since birth, was born to sighted parents who raised him with a can-do attitude., Michael rode a bike and learned to do advanced math in his head! He moved to California and attended college receiving a master's degree in Physics and a secondary teaching credential. Michael worked for high-tech companies in management roles until September 11, 2001 when he and his guide dog, Roselle, escaped from the 78th floor of Tower One in the WTC. They were then thrust into the international limelight where Michael began to share lessons of trust, courage, and teamwork as a public speaker. Mike is the author of the #1 NY Times Bestseller: “Thunder dog” – selling over 2.5 million copies. In 2014 he published his 2nd book “Running with Roselle”, A story for our youth. On this episode of the Road to Paris, Travis Mewhirter breaks down the European Continental Cup -- a fancy way of saying Olympic trial -- where France's Arnaud Gauthier-Rat and Teo Rotar, and Julien Lyneel and Remi Bassereau went absolute clutch mode and clinched a second Olympic spot for the French men. Meanwhile, four young Dutch women, Brecht Piersma and Wies Bekhuis, and Kirsten Broring and Emi van Driel, won the bid for the women...or so you might think. But a weird rule in the Netherlands has muddied things up a bit, and Mewhirter explains what in the world is happening (as best he can). Thanks as always to Producers 1 and 2, for you, the viewers.
